This post should not be taken as a polished recommendation to AI companies and instead should be treated as an informal summary of a worldview. The content is inspired by conversations with a large number of people, so I cannot take credit for any of these ideas.

For a summary of this post, see the thread on X.

Many people write opinions about how to handle advanced AI, which can be considered “plans.”

There's the “stop AI now plan.”

On the other side of the aisle, there's the “build AI faster plan.”

Some plans try to strike a balance with an idyllic governance regime.

And others have a “race sometimes, pause sometimes, it will be a dumpster-fire” vibe.

So why am I proposing another plan?

Existing plans provide a nice patchwork of the options available, but I’m not satisfied with any.
